tig
Tig is a fantastic GITK alternative for those who prefer a text-mode interface for Git. It acts as an excellent Git repository browser and can even serve as a pager for various Git command outputs. As a Free, Open Source solution available on Mac, Linux, BSD, and Cygwin, Tig offers powerful text mode capabilities and convenient Vim key mapping, making it a strong contender for command-line enthusiasts.

GitX
For Mac users seeking a graphical GITK alternative, GitX is an excellent choice. It's an OS X (MacOS) native graphical client specifically designed for the git version control system. Being Free and Open Source, GitX provides an intuitive visual interface for managing your version control and source code, offering a more visual approach compared to command-line tools.

gitin
gitin presents itself as a minimalist command-line tool for exploring Git repositories, making it a viable GITK alternative for those who value simplicity and efficiency. Available for Free on Mac and Linux, gitin allows you to search commits, inspect individual files, and review changes directly from your command line, offering a lightweight yet effective way to interact with your repositories.
